Bleep after installing Kx driver. Cant get red of it!!

Hello,

I installed the kx driver some month's ago. I had a big project and the driver of my Lexicon Omega USB sound card did not work anymore. I ended up replacing the omega and moved to a different system. Simply because there was a big problem all together.

However, on my system with the Omega I cant get rid of the bleep. I removed Kx drivers completely, yet the bleep is still there..

Problem:
A bleep every 30 to 60 seconds, as soon as Vista starts.

Cause:
Unknown; problem appeared after installing kx drivers.

OS: Win Vista
Mobo: Asus Pn5

All in all, my whole system is being hijacked ever since I installed the kx Asio...

Re: Bleep after installing Kx driver. Cant get red of it!!

It seems he/she haven't any kX compatible device...
I read something about USB device (they are not supported by kX), and about Lexicon Omega (which is not emu10k1 or emu10k2 device)...
So, probably there is another conflict.
It is strange how kX is installed if there are no compatible devices.
